About Athlone

Athlone is a vibrant and historic town located in County Westmeath, in the midlands region of Ireland. It is known for its rich cultural heritage, stunning landscapes, and friendly locals.

One of the best ways to experience Athlone is to take a walk through the town and explore its many attractions. Be sure to visit Athlone Castle, which is a 12th century castle that offers stunning views of the surrounding landscape. Visitors can take a guided tour of the castle and learn about its rich history.

Another must-see attraction in Athlone is the Luan Gallery, which is home to a collection of contemporary Irish art. The gallery is located in the heart of the town and is a great place to spend an afternoon exploring the many exhibits on display.
